outdent-string工具:清除多行字符串前导空格

下载需积分: 5 | ZIP格式 | 19KB | 更新于2024-11-25 | 89 浏览量 | 0 下载量 举报
收藏
该项目在2014年进行了测试,使用了最新的Firefox、Safari和Chrome浏览器。尽管可以正常工作,但开发者已指出该工具可能存在不稳定性和性能问题。该项目并未提供详尽的文献资料,但通过直接查看源代码和运行演示页面可以对工具的功能和使用有初步了解。要运行演示页面,可以使用PHP的内置开发服务器,并通过指定地址在浏览器中访问。标签为HTML,说明该项目主要针对HTML字符串处理。压缩包中的文件名只有一个,名为outdent-string-main,可能包含了这个JavaScript库的核心功能代码和相关文件。" 知识点: 1. **多行字符串的前导空格处理**: 在编程中,尤其是处理从文件或用户输入中获得的多行字符串时,常常需要消除每行开头不必要的空格,以保证代码格式的整洁或者数据的准确性。"outdent-string"作为一个JavaScript工具,它的主要功能就是提供一种方法来检测并删除这些多余的前导空格。 2. **HTML代码格式化**: HTML作为一种标记语言,其代码格式的整洁性对于可读性和维护性非常重要。例如,在表格、列表或段落中,如果前导空格不一致,可能会导致页面渲染不正确或者布局混乱。使用"outdent-string"可以帮助开发者清理HTML代码,使得每一行的起始位置都保持一致。 3. **浏览器兼容性**: 该工具在最新的Firefox、Safari和Chrome浏览器中进行了测试。这表明其开发者考虑到了跨浏览器工作的兼容性问题。然而,由于这是一个实验性项目,不同的浏览器可能会出现不同的问题,开发者需要在实际使用时对各个浏览器进行充分的测试。 4. **JavaScript实验性工具**: "outdent-string"被定义为一个实验性的JavaScript工具,这意味着它可能包含一些未经充分验证或可能不稳定的功能。在实际应用中,开发者需要谨慎评估其性能和稳定性,并且可能需要根据实际情况对代码进行调整和优化。 5. **PHP内置开发服务器的使用**: 开发者提供了如何运行演示页面的具体指导,包括使用PHP内置的开发服务器。这对于不熟悉PHP开发环境的人来说是一个有用的实践,有助于在本地环境中快速搭建并测试Web应用。 6. **源代码查看和运行**: "outdent-string"项目虽然没有提供详细的文献资料,但是开发者鼓励用户直接查看源代码来获得初步了解。这说明该工具的使用可能比较直接,代码结构可能比较清晰,使得即使是初学者也能通过阅读代码来理解其工作原理。 7. **压缩包文件结构**: 由于提供的文件压缩包中只包含了一个名为"outdent-string-main"的文件,这表明该JavaScript工具的实现可能非常集中,主要功能可能都包含在了这一个文件中。对于想要了解和学习该工具的人来说,这是一个很好的起点。 以上知识点涵盖了"outdent-string"工具的主要功能和使用情境,对于开发者来说,这些信息有助于在进行相关项目开发时选择合适的工具,并了解在实际操作中可能遇到的问题和注意事项。

相关推荐